I just want to spend a whole lot of money for tires thats all.

Don't is the word im guessing u left out.....Cheap tires are just that...CHEAP. They can do more damage and give you less service than any savings you might see on the purchase. These chinese tires are shipped over here in a ships hull, laying in all kind of crushed abnormal positions that they never recover from. They're out of round, belts slip within miles sometimes and it shakes your car to pieces because they cant get them balanced right without hanging a boat anchor on your wheels....Ive seen a tireman put 6 weights on a wheel to get 1 balanced...
Tires are not that damn expensive compared to the overall costs...get some decent ones at least. Mastercraft is a decent cheap tire that is usually avail most everywhere....

Tirerack is awesome. Bought the last three sets . Can call them and teel them waht you are looking for. Very knowledgeable. They ship and refer you to a shop close to you to have put on and it is all quaranteed.Was refered to a tire i really wasn't that familar with and it is the best tire i ever got for my M/B Suv.
